Just imagine the billions of rands that will be lost from just this act and the devastating effect it will have on small business owners and the poor.
The party has the right, like everyone else, to protest but to shut down everything and expect everyone to take part is just out of order and totally irresponsible on the side of EFF leaders, who may not feel the daily pressures of a tight economy.
They don’t care and this just smells of an electioneering strategy in preparation for next year’s general election. With the Phala Phala burglary scandal failing to make Ramaphosa resign, there is no way he will roll over for the EFF at this point.
